From 05009a6255729cdef16e5f35c8005a1befe3f117 Mon Sep 17 00:00:00 2001 From: kaleb-himes Date: Wed, 27 May 2020 14:35:39 -0600 Subject: [PATCH] Add executable to ignore, add check for FP_MAX_BITS --- .gitignore | 1 + .../test-cert-privkey-pair | Bin 13224 -> 0 bytes .../test-cert-privkey-pair.c | 8 ++++++++ 3 files changed, 9 insertions(+) delete mode 100755 pk/test_cert_and_private_keypair/test-cert-privkey-pair diff --git a/.gitignore b/.gitignore index 623487a5..993bbbf8 100644 --- a/.gitignore +++ b/.gitignore @@ -184,6 +184,7 @@ pk/ED25519/sign_and_verify pk/ecdh_generate_secret/ecdh_gen_secret pk/rsa-kg/rsa-kg-sv pk/dh-pg/dh-pg-ka +pk/test_cert_and_private_keypair/test-cert-privkey-pair wolfCLU/tests/somejunk/*somejunk*.txt diff --git a/pk/test_cert_and_private_keypair/test-cert-privkey-pair b/pk/test_cert_and_private_keypair/test-cert-privkey-pair deleted file mode 100755 index d744f401e8a876f8b66c1ec1aa09fe196f6cb25e..0000000000000000000000000000000000000000 GIT binary patch literal 0 HcmV?d00001 literal 13224 zcmeHOU1%It6rQwAjpHPj zxh#a^7W#AYf!(b7)>( zWd=Qz7i3AHyn;Ooku!udKHOi(i4oVnWxN0{4e`qJ!n38V^Hz|(5NX3TmK5Rq61taP zjqgIaJl@hwk6U^^lU;`n#yh%#XRA51PspTq{b0nMEuaVR{7V;fT)PINKSjEFm&=ypKzlhQF#oP{h0im#j>gA0T6FAa&gze* z$8%}OqbAcDNCemH_SZv<^=-WEt(v}m7W+D>%H$eI0F zYuI$6V+DIC>Y9$*Vc8IJnIPsu(h`$MwtmVJ-xQ|OaZ_w`|j^)57SzzV0c3^o4? za?A2HW&Q_pe36*HOs<983_0#${sKAv$}s;Sxi`qYM~+y{zeDaja%aH>rz#J6QIJR5 zX;?Wkt-A$1S1{6gcTX2CN?bn}Kdv`AJ9X2x3${LHID7TRbgdThZjbk*x;nesIb#Ly zI464(Yx^9$GU;hEV-$0)qkFfE`RGPI9f&fcR6*w(mR@kPrme#xO0_;>Shj8#^ZJNt-X*Rv<;Jk zxF%PUxyaQF+tdxY=5{SbuVvPJ!Sy|WvV6DRN(NLu;#}oB>~4%~ALI8+5_!J+uE)%J zIUB$0uUmr)s7N885Kssx1QY@a0fm4bvPySH+55?|YZKrR>#i@Ov26 zbYLVaDT2OSj)ml|kbKyaxs0Sdddy#xPle<&A^C%l{B20S=E;lsv9^T&r@=aW*1Th@ zvK}9m*Rt-L_0Vh3SdQ{= 8192) && \ + defined(USE_FAST_MATH) printf("\nUsing defaults server.key and server.cert\n"); printf("To test other key/cert pair run with:\n"); printf("./test-cert-privkey-pair yourkey.pem yourcert.pem\n\n\n"); + #else + printf("FP_MAX_BITS set too low to run the default 4096-bit pair\n"); + printf("Please build with FP_MAX_BITS set to 8192 or greater when\n" + "using fastmath to test the defaults\n"); + return -1; + #endif } ctx = wolfSSL_CTX_new(wolfSSLv23_server_method());